Self Motivation Tips We Can All Use

What drives people to succeed when others fail? Is self motivation only for the go getters? It may come as a surprise to many people that even the most influential people have days when they get out of bed and dont feel motivated. How do those people stay focused and driven towards achieving what they want? In the following paragraphs, you will read everyday tips that anyone can use to keep the spark going.

Make a Goal

This doesnt have to be complex. Making goals just depends on your desires. Goal setting is one of the most popular ways to develop self motivation. By setting a goal, you have come to a decision on what you want to accomplish. Motivation in this case, can come from wanting to see a goal achieved. For some people though, setting a goal isnt enough. They face issues with staying on task and following through to the goal.

Do Some Reading

Across the world, people find that reading motivational, inspirational, or humorous quotations can help to inspire their self motivation, and often keeps them focused and driven. If reading other peoples funny and inspirational excerpts isnt for you, then make up your own. If you have a goal, it can help to write it down and post it somewhere you can see it every day. For instance, if you want to stick to your diet write your goal weight on a magnetic dry erase board and put it on the refrigerator. When you are tempted to sneak one last piece of cheesecake, you might think twice when you can see your goal in front of you. Maybe you just need a daily pick me up. Write down that unique saying grandma always said, and whenever you need self motivation, take it out and read it. Youll feel refreshed and moved, and you will fondly remember someone you love.

Switch Gears

Have you ever been involved in something and suddenly found that it no longer interests you? Dont worry - you are not the only person to experience this lack of self motivation. At one point or another, everyone finds that the task they are doing to goal they are trying to reach no longer holds their interest. When you find yourself experiencing a lack of passion for a task that once held your interest, its okay to work on something else. Getting involved in a new project or other task even for a short while can reignite the motivation that you had been missing.

Reward Yourself

Occasionally, a reward for obtaining a halfway mark in reaching a goal can be just the ticket to keeping self motivation from becoming discouraging. Everyone likes to be rewarded for something they have done well. So, whether you are trying to catch up on chores, your to-do list, or lose weight, find a way to reward yourself for working as hard as you have been. It will increase your self motivation, and keep you happier in the long run.

Look Within Yourself

Possibly one of the most important things to think about when finding ways to keep your self motivation in the forefront is to look inside you. Take a moment during a time of day that is peaceful to meditate. Jot down your thoughts about what keeps you motivated and reflect on times when youve had a great deal of determination. When you think back, you can come to realize that you have the motivation that you need. Through looking to the person you are and taking what you know and have experienced to reach and realize your goals and ideas, you will become better at finding ways to achieve self motivation.
